When it comes to price and running costs, the biggest differences usually appear. This is often where you see which car fits your budget better in the long run.
Alfa Romeo Junior has a to a small extent advantage in terms of price – it starts at 25700 £, while the VinFast VF 6 costs 30000 £. That’s a price difference of around 4320 £.
Range is almost identical – both manage about 410 km on a single charge.
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.
When it comes to engine power, the Alfa Romeo Junior has a noticeable edge – offering 280 HP compared to 204 HP. That’s roughly 76 HP more horsepower.
There’s also a difference in torque: Alfa Romeo Junior pulls a bit stronger with 345 Nm compared to 310 Nm. That’s about 35 Nm difference.
Beyond pure performance, interior space and usability matter most in daily life. This is where you see which car is more practical and versatile.
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In curb weight, Alfa Romeo Junior is significantly lighter – 1380 kg compared to 1970 kg. The difference is around 590 kg.
In terms of boot space, the Alfa Romeo Junior offers convincingly more room – 415 L compared to 0 L. That’s a difference of about 415 L.
When it comes to payload, VinFast VF 6 slight takes the win – 438 kg compared to 420 kg. That’s a difference of about 18 kg.
